Hexafluorocobaltate (III) ion is a high spin complex. The hybrid state of cobalt is

A

`d^(2)sp^(3)`

B

`sp^(3)d^(2)`

C

`dsp^(2)`

D

`sp^(3)d`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
B

The formula of the ion is `[CoF_(6)]^(3-)` . It is an octahedral complex with high spin . As such the hybrid state should be `sp^(3)d^(2)` .
